免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

html5开发app简单

HTML5开发App是一种跨平台的应用程序开发方式,通过使用HTML、CSS和JavaScript技术,可以在各种设备上运行,包括桌面电脑、移动设备和智能电视等。它的原理是利用HTML5的新特性和API,通过浏览器来运行应用程序,使开发者可以更加灵活地开发、测试和发布应用。

HTML5开发App的优点之一是跨平台兼容性。通过使用HTML、CSS和JavaScript,我们可以编写一套代码,然后在不同的平台上运行。这样一来,开发者不需要为每个平台编写不同的代码,减少了开发时间和成本。另外,HTML5还支持响应式设计,可以根据不同设备的屏幕大小自动适应布局,提供更好的用户体验。

在开始HTML5开发App之前,我们需要了解一些基础知识。首先,了解HTML、CSS和JavaScript的基本语法和用法是必要的。HTML用于创建网页的结构和内容,CSS用于样式化网页,JavaScript用于实现网页的动态效果和交互。另外,还需要了解一些常用的HTML5特性和API,如Canvas、LocalStorage、Web Workers、Web Socket等。

接下来,我们可以使用各种工具和框架来简化开发过程。常用的HTML5开发工具包括文本编辑器、集成开发环境、调试工具等。例如,Sublime Text、Visual Studio Code、WebStorm等都是常用的文本编辑器,它们提供了代码高亮、语法检查、自动补全等功能。另外,可以利用调试工具来调试和测试应用程序,如Chrome浏览器的开发者工具、Firebug等。

除了工具之外,还可以使用一些框架和库来简化开发过程。常用的HTML5开发框架包括Bootstrap、Foundation、Ionic等,它们提供了丰富的UI组件和样式,并支持响应式设计。另外,还可以使用一些JavaScript库来实现特定功能,如jQuery、React、Angular等。

在开始开发之前,我们需要根据需求进行应用程序的设计和规划。首先,确定应用程序的功能和界面设计,考虑用户的需求和使用习惯。然后,根据设计稿或原型图,开始编写HTML、CSS和JavaScript代码。在编写过程中,可以使用工具和框架来提高效率和质量。

在开发完成之后,我们需要对应用程序进行测试和优化。可以使用各种测试工具和技术,如单元测试、集成测试、性能测试等。通过测试,可以发现并修复潜在的问题,提高应用程序的质量和稳定性。另外,还可以使用一些优化技术来提高应用程序的性能和加载速度,如压缩和合并静态资源、懒加载、缓存等。

最后,我们需要将应用程序发布到各个平台,并进行推广和运营。可以利用各种应用商店和市场,如App Store、Google Play、小米应用商店等,将应用程序分发给用户。同时,可以使用各种推广渠道和方式,如社交媒体、广告投放、SEO等,吸引用户下载和使用应用程序。

总结来说,HTML5开发App是一种灵活、跨平台的应用程序开发方式。通过使用HTML、CSS和JavaScript技术,我们可以在各种设备上运行应用程序,提供优秀的用户体验。在开发过程中,我们需要掌握基本知识、使用工具和框架、进行设计和规划、测试和优化,并最终将应用程序发布和推广给用户。希望以上介绍能够帮助你了解HTML5开发App的简单原理和详细步骤。


相关知识:
企业为什么要选择app开发
随着移动互联网的快速发展,越来越多的企业开始意识到移动应用的重要性。企业选择开发自己的移动应用程序(APP),不仅可以更好地满足用户的需求,提升用户体验,还可以进一步加强企业品牌的影响力和知名度。下面详细介绍企业为什么要选择APP开发。1. 扩大用户覆盖面
2024-01-10
app开发文献综述
App开发是指开发移动设备上的应用程序,包括Android和iOS等操作系统上的应用程序。随着智能手机的普及,App开发成为了一个热门的领域,吸引了越来越多的开发者加入进来。App开发的原理主要涉及以下几个方面:1. 开发环境:App开发需要使用特定的开发
2023-06-29
app开发课程安排
开发一个成功的App需要从一开始就认真制定计划、安排时间,并遵循一些基本步骤。以下是一个涉及到app开发理论与详细介绍的课程安排:第一章:概述- App的发展历程- 工具和资源的选择- 应用类型和目标用户- APP基本组成部分- APP的体验和界面设计-
2023-06-29
app开发结构图
移动应用程序(Mobile Apps)是指可以在移动设备上安装和运行的软件程序,如智能手机、平板电脑等移动设备。随着智能手机的普及,移动应用程序成为了人们生活中不可或缺的一部分。在移动应用程序中,app是最广泛使用的一种。那么,app开发的结构图是什么样的
2023-06-29
app开发的一些外围服务
在移动应用的开发过程中,除了编写代码以外,还需要涉及到一些外围服务。这些外围服务能够帮助开发人员更好地完成开发任务,提高开发效率。本文将介绍一些常用的外围服务,包括云存储、推送服务、地图服务、支付服务以及广告服务等。1. 云存储云存储是一种将数据存储在云端
2023-06-29
app简单开发制作
手机应用程序(App)在现代社会已经成为日常生活中不可缺少的一部分,因此越来越多的人通过开发自己的App来满足市场需求。本文将介绍一些简单的App开发原理和制作方法。一、App开发的原理App的开发可以分为以下几个阶段:1. 需求分析在开发App之前,需要
2023-05-06